WebApr 14, 2024 · Bubble time is the cruellest time in a poker tournament. It’s also the most anxious, often the busiest at the rail and among the media but, when all’s said and done, usually the slowest too. For the uninitiated, “the bubble” bursts when the last remaining player goes out of the tournament without earning any money. WebMovie Info. Chapter 10 - ‘No More Boom and Bust’: The Subprime Bubble
WebAug 6, 2024 · Then at the start of October 1929, the Wall Street crash occurred, and the market had lost 48 per cent of its value in a matter of five weeks. The chapter then moves on to explore how the bubble triangle explains the US bubble during the roaring twenties. The spark was electrification, which rapidly transformed the American economy.
